%0 Journal Article %@nexthigherunit 8JMKD3MGPCW/43SQKNE %@holdercode {isadg {BR SPINPE} ibi 8JMKD3MGPCW/3DT298S} %@resumeid %@resumeid 8JMKD3MGP5W/3C9JHNM %X The active and break periods of the South America monsoon system (SAMS) were determined based on a monsoon rainfall index (MRI) for the three wettest months. The precipitation composite for active cases shows a pattern similar to the average summer rainfall. The wind circulation composite presents a strong northwesterly flow from the western Amazon to southeastern Brazil. During the active (break) periods, an intense (weak) moisture flux convergence occurs over the Amazon basin, southeastern and central-western Brazil. The intense moisture convergence over these regions during the active periods is a typical feature of the South Atlantic convergence zone (SACZ) system. Copyright.
